Wait faithfully. Listen closely. March boldly. The Not a Moment Late Leader Guide outlines six small group sessions complete with prayers, summaries, discussion questions, and video viewer guides. The leader guide will support group leaders of all experience levels in creating strong learning communities. Ever feel like you're waiting forever for God to show up? You're not alone. Meet Deborah--a woman who knew something about divine timing that we desperately need to learn today. Deborah wasn't just sitting around waiting for life to happen. She was a warrior, a wife, a prophet, and a judge who understood how to move in sync with God's perfect timing. Her story isn't just ancient history--it's a roadmap for anyone tired of rushing ahead or falling behind God's plan. In our instant-everything culture, Deborah's journey teaches us that the best things really do come to those who wait -- and act when God says, "Go." Her warrior cry echoes through the ages: "March on with courage!" Through this transformative journey with Deborah, you'll learn how to live with more patience and discover the power of perseverance. You'll spend more time enjoying God's presence while practicing listening for His voice. Most importantly, you'll remember that delays are not denials and learn to march on with courage in the midst of adversity. Deborah's story becomes your story. Her courage becomes your courage. Are you ready to march on? The participant workbook includes five daily readings for each week, combining the study of Scripture with personal reflection, application, and prayer. Other components for the Bible study include a Participant Workbook with daily readings and teaching video available on DVD.
Autorenporträt
Lisa Toney loves to speak and write about ways to build easy, intentional, and powerful faith habits to live for Jesus. As a professor of spiritual formation at Hope International University, diving into "why this is helpful for one's life" is right up her alley. For over twenty years as a full-time pastor, she's listened, learned, taught, and served side-by-side with the church. Her company, Faith Habits, provides classes, coaching, and media to encourage engagement with God. She has a degree in communications from Taylor University and an MDiv from Fuller Theological Seminary. Lisa speaks at events nationwide such as Women of Faith and the Aspire Women's Events. She is the author of Thrive: Live Like You Matter, The Scripture Challenge, The Wholehearted Psalms Devotion series, and Perfectly Flawed: God Transforms Our Weaknesses into Strengths. Lisa lives in Southern California with her husband, four kids, a puppy, a gecko, and five chickens. She loves to take groups to the Bible lands (Israel, Greece, Italy, Turkey, and other destinations) with InspireTravelGroup.org and walk where the unstoppable, incomparable, life-changing movement of Jesus began.
